Least educated, Maine counties · 2010

Maine counties with the smallest share of adults 25+ holding a bachelor's degree or higher (2010 ACS). This list covers the 16 counties in Maine that qualify, ranked against each other statewide.

RANKPLACESTATEPOPBACHELOR'S DEGREE OR HIGHERVS 2000
01Piscataquis County, MEME17,40915.0%+13%
02Somerset County, MEME51,62015.3%+30%
03Aroostook County, MEME66,60916.2%+10%
04Androscoggin County, MEME116,48718.4%+28%
05Oxford County, MEME60,34618.5%+18%
06Washington County, MEME31,33419.0%+30%
07Waldo County, MEME40,69323.1%+3%
08Penobscot County, MEME157,96723.3%+15%
09Kennebec County, MEME129,06724.1%+16%
10Franklin County, MEME30,82424.5%+17%
11York County, MEME222,43426.7%+17%
12Knox County, MEME41,11726.9%+3%
13Sagadahoc County, MEME37,97929.6%+18%
14Hancock County, MEME57,17130.1%+11%
15Lincoln County, MEME36,59531.6%+19%
16Cumberland County, MEME317,22239.5%+15%
